Master Switch

CAUTION: The following test are performed with lockout switch closed (non-lockout position)
  1. Remove master switch from vehicle. Test using self-powered test light or ohmmeter. Replace window control switch if continuity is not as specified in testing. With switch in neutral position, continuity should be present between terminals "A" and "B", "D" and "E", "I" and "L", and terminals "K" and "M". See Fig 1 .
  2. Right Front Circuit With master switch in right front UP position, continuity should be present between terminals "A" and "B", "D" and "E", "I" and "L", and terminals "J"and "K". With switch in right front DOWN position, continuity should be present between terminals "A" and "B", "D" and "E", "I" and "", and terminals "K" and "M".
  3. Left Front Circuit With master switch in left front UP position, continuity should be present between terminals "A" and "B", "C" and "D", "I" and "L", and terminals "K" and "M". With switch in left front DOWN position, continuity should be present between terminals "B" and "C", "D" and "E", "I" and "L", and terminals "K" and "M".
Fig 1: Master Switch Test Terminals (Mark VIII)
